**Undo/redo model in Draftloom**

Draftloom stores edits as a linear command stack with coalescing: rapid drags on the same shape merge into one undo step, keyed by a quiet-period timer. Redo history is discarded on any new command, standard behavior. Memory is bounded by capping stack depth and snapshotting the full document every N commands so deep undos don't replay thousands of ops. Contractors touching the history module should not change coalescing semantics without a design review. Current limits are set as follows.

tuning table, kajog-kawef:
PRIORITIES = {
    "kelox": 870,
    "kasix": 89,
    "eliax": 988,
}

UserSplit Cutover Drift: the extracted account service and the legacy Marigold monolith user module are reporting divergent record counts during dual-write. This fires when drift exceeds 0.5% over 15 minutes. New team members should not replay writes manually. Reconciliation steps and the rollback procedure are documented on the internal page.

wiki page, tajog-fafog: https://gitlab.paliqsys.corp/dash/display/job/853dd6fcbf54

# Gatewright Environments

We run three environments: dev, staging, and prod. All schema migrations go through the expand-contract flow — no locking DDL, ever. Staging mirrors prod's data shape weekly, so test your migration there first and watch the dual-write metrics. If prod looks off mid-migration, pause the contract step, don't roll back. Staging currently runs with the following configuration.

settings of yahaf-tahop:
jorox:
  pin: 5851
  tenant: noveth
  seal: seal_7ddb5c42
  metrics_host: metrics.jorox.ordinnet.example
  standby_team: wenax
  escalation: oliath-feneth
  nonce: 552548

# Vertigo elevator-dispatch simulator — env config.
# On-call: sim workers read this file at boot. Car count,
# floor topology, and tick rate are set in sim.yaml, not here.
# This file holds runtime creds only. The dispatch broker
# rejects unauthenticated workers after 30s. Its auth token
# goes on the line directly below.

sealed setting: VAULT_KEY20=69e2a0b23f1a79fbf692